very well done, good video, however:
-tell him not to hold the blank in his hands when squaring the ends with the mill! many turners on this web sites can attest how this can easily gauge your hand, not to mention stain the blank with blood!!
-wear gloves when applying CA! you risk to spens the next hour separating a folded paper towel from your index DAMHIKT.
